Nevertheless, you could have come across the expression “one hundred ten% loan to worth” and puzzled what it means. This idea refers to the mortgage loan exactly where the loan sum exceeds the appraised worth or buy cost of the assets.

The LTV is expressed like a share which is calculated by dividing the loan volume through the appraised benefit or buy cost of the assets. It provides insight into the amount of fairness (ownership) the borrower has while in the home.
Zero-coupon bonds do not fork out interest specifically. Alternatively, borrowers provide bonds in a deep discounted to their deal with value, then shell out the face value once the website bond matures. An unsecured loan is surely an arrangement to pay a loan back again with no collateral. Due to the fact there isn't a collateral included, lenders want a method to validate the economic integrity of their borrowers.
“To find out your LTV ratio, divide the loan total by the worth of your asset, and afterwards multiply by one hundred to obtain a percentage,” describes Experian.
Lenders are generally hesitant to lend large quantities of revenue with no warranty. Secured loans reduce the chance of the borrower defaulting since they danger losing whatever asset they place up as collateral.
